Trader Joe's Recalls Over 60,000 Pounds of Frozen Dumplings Due to Plastic Contamination
• Trader Joe's recalled over 61,000 pounds of frozen Steamed Chicken Soup Dumplings due to potential hard plastic contamination from a permanent marker pen.
• The dumplings were sold nationwide and produced on December 7, 2023. Two lot codes are affected - "03.07.25.C1-1" and "03.07.25.C1-2".
• The recall was initiated after consumers complained about finding hard plastic pieces in the product.
• Consumers are advised to throw away or return the dumplings. No injuries have been reported.
